For those not familiar, Yo! Sushi, opening to the public
tomorrow, is a Japanese restaurant offering ‘tasty and healthy sushi’ as well
as a wide variety of meat, vegetarian, rice and noodle dishes; including one of
our favourites, the Chicken Katsu Curry. All of this is of course topped off
with plenty of desserts, if you’re not too full after a menu boasting over 80
different dishes!!! We were only too keen to hear that they are also offering a
takeaway service, ideal for those team lunches, as well as sushi making classes.
